WORLD CONGRESS ON THE ABDOMINAL COMPARTMENT SYNDROME

The next World Congress on the Abdominal Compartment Syndrome (ACS) will be held in Dublin in 2009. 

The World Society on Abdominal Compartment Syndrome (WSACS) was founded at the 2004 World Congress on the Abdominal Compartment Syndrome. This scientific meeting was held at the Sheraton Noosa Resort - Queensland, Australia - December 6th to 8th,2004. All who have an interest in the diagnosis, management, and treatment of Intra-Abdominal Hypertension (IAH) and Abdominal Compartment Syndrome (ACS) are invited to join the Society.  Click here to go to the website www.wsacs.org.
